**Brief Job Description**
We are looking for a self-motivated, results-driven individual who would be a good addition to our team in the maintenance department. The Maintenance Planner ensures the coordination and purchasing of parts; monitoring of maintenance projects; and work orders at the facility.
**Responsibilities**
- Ordering Process - General supply inventory checks, documentation and ordering of inventory for special projects, PO Creation and Sending, Management of supply ordering database, daily, weekly monthly ordering.
- Preventive Maintenance - Develop, implement and maintain preventive maintenance programs.
- Work Order Management - Assign work order resources, review completed work orders, develop and maintain tracking system for preventive maintenance.
- Planning & Scheduling work - Plant weekly schedule of work by allocating manpower or contractor in coordination with Maintenance Supervisor, Estimate the labour required for the completion of work order, non-stock material purchase requisition for work order completion.
- Project Management - Facilitates team planning meets, develop project plan and schedule and allocate resources, track and report on project reports.
- Contractor Management - Assist in contractor management with initial quotes, receiving quotes, project job scope as well as coordinating on-site supervision
- Invoicing - Management of account payable process.
- Record Keeping - Maintaining electronic and paper filing for planning activities, asset history, equipment maintenance history, work order, program documentation and staff training.
- Budgeting - Assist in managing budget and capital cost.
- Standard Work - Creation, review, revision of standard work (Work orders Preventive maintenance, daily work).
- 5s Audit Management & Reporting.
- And other duties as required.
